changeset 50:d309241fcae3

fc-rfcal-gmagic ready to test
author Mychaela Falconia <falcon@freecalypso.org>
date Sat, 27 May 2017 07:33:39 +0000
parents 1a0dbc746d57
children fe39aac56cde
files autocal/gmagicmain.c
diffstat 1 files changed, 8 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/autocal/gmagicmain.c	Sat May 27 07:23:20 2017 +0000
+++ b/autocal/gmagicmain.c	Sat May 27 07:33:39 2017 +0000
@@ -64,6 +64,9 @@
 main(argc, argv)
 	char **argv;
 {
+	int pm, Gmagic;
+	char Gmagic_db[64];
+
 	socket_pathname_options(argc, argv);
 	finish_cmdline(argc, argv);
 	connect_rvinterf_socket();
@@ -75,6 +78,9 @@
 	do_tms(1);
 	do_rfpw(STD_BAND_FLAG, selected_band->rfpw_std_band);
 	l1tm_setup_for_rxcal();
-
-
+	pm = rx_measure(arfcn);
+	Gmagic = pm - RXCAL_SIGGEN_LEVEL - RXCAL_AGC_DB * 2;
+	halfdb_to_string(Gmagic, Gmagic_db);
+	printf("GMagic=%d (%s dB)\n", Gmagic, Gmagic_db);
+	exit(0);
 }